Noosa Micro-Markets

Ranking across Noosa's
distinct micro-markets.

Noosa isn't one market - it's four or five overlapping ones, and each rewards a different local SEO approach. A tradie working out of Tewantin and a cafe on Hastings Street are competing for entirely different searches and entirely different customer profiles. Knowing which sub-market you actually serve makes the difference between ranking and disappearing.

Hastings Street & Noosa Main Beach

The tourist-facing core - cafes, restaurants, surf shops, boutiques. Search volume is enormous (visitors and locals both Google here daily), and so is the competition. Established businesses with a decade of review history dominate. For a hospitality business breaking into this space, the play is photo strategy, fresh review velocity, and getting recognised in "best [thing] noosa" searches that holidaymakers run from their hotel rooms.

Noosaville

Noosaville is where the working market lives - trades, marine services, automotive, casual dining, and the river-side businesses. Searches lean local and practical: "plumber Noosaville", "boat mechanic Noosa", "lunch Gympie Terrace". Competition is more reasonable than Hastings Street, and review momentum compounds faster here because the customer base is repeat-business locals, not one-time visitors.

Tewantin

Tewantin has the most established residential community in the Noosa shire - older locals, lower turnover, strong word-of-mouth networks. Local SEO here is an amplifier of reputation that already exists. Trades and home services with two or three years of local work behind them tend to rank quickly once their profile is properly set up. The barrier is usually low because most Tewantin competitors have done little online beyond a basic listing.

Sunshine Beach & Peregian

Premium residential stretches from Sunshine Beach south through Peregian, with high-net-worth homeowners commissioning everything from architectural renovations to bespoke landscaping. Searches are lower volume but higher value - one ranking position can mean a $50,000 job rather than a $500 one. Photos and previous-work portfolios matter more than review count for trades operating in this bracket.

Why Local SEO Matters in Noosa

Noosa's high-value market rewards
strong local SEO.

Noosa has one of the most distinct customer profiles on the Sunshine Coast. Permanent residents are often well-resourced professionals or retirees with high expectations - they're not hunting for the cheapest option, they're hunting for the most credible one. And then there's the short-stay market: thousands of Airbnb properties and holiday lets generating constant demand for cleaners, maintenance trades, and property services, particularly around the school holiday peaks.

The challenge in Noosa is that the market's premium positioning cuts both ways. Customers here check reviews carefully, and a sparse or dated Google profile will cost you jobs regardless of how good your work is. A business in Noosaville with 60 recent reviews and professional photos will win the booking over a competitor with 8 reviews - even if that competitor has been trading in Noosa for fifteen years.

Realistic Targets

What's actually winnable
in Noosa right now.

Some Noosa rankings are genuinely tough. Others are quietly available if you put consistent work in. An honest read of where the opportunities sit:

Hospitality on Hastings Street is hard. Cafes, restaurants, and boutiques on Hastings have decade-deep review profiles and thousands of holidaymaker reviews each year. Climbing into the top three for "cafe noosa" or "restaurant noosa" is a multi-year project. If you're new in this space, the realistic play is ranking for category-specific terms - "breakfast noosa", "thai food noosa heads", "natural wine noosa" - rather than the broad ones.

Trades, cleaners, and home services are winnable. Most Noosa trades businesses have basic Google profiles with infrequent activity. A profile that's actively managed with steady review velocity (one or two new reviews a fortnight) and consistent posts can break the top three for trade-specific suburb queries within three to six months. This is the bracket where most of our Noosa work lives.

Holiday-let support services have unusually low competition. "Airbnb cleaner Noosa", "holiday let maintenance Noosaville", "vacation rental linen Noosa" - these are high-intent searches with surprisingly few well-optimised competitors. Property managers run them every week and call the first result. If your business serves this niche, the local SEO opportunity is significant and the work to capture it is straightforward.

Premium trades for the high-end residential market sit in their own bracket. Lower search volume, but each enquiry can be substantial. Profile aesthetics - photo quality, response professionalism, project portfolios - matter more here than raw review count. We position these clients to be seen as the credible choice rather than the cheapest one.
